BMW 5 Series:
The BMW 5 Series is an executive car manufactured and marketed by BMW since 1972. It is the successor to the BMW New Class sedans and is currently in its eighth generation. The car is sold as either a sedan or, since 1991, a station wagon. A 5-door fastback was sold between 2009 and 2017. Each successive generation has been given an internal G-code designation since 2017. Previously, a F-code designation was used between 2010 and 2016, while an E-code designation was used between 1972 and 2010. Pros and Cons:
Pros:
- • Exceptional ride quality and handling balance
- • Refined and powerful engine lineup (especially inline-six and V8 petrols, and M57 diesels)
- • High-quality interior materials and build
- • Timeless and elegant exterior design
- • Spacious and practical Touring body style
- • Excellent value on the used market
Cons:
- • Potential for age-related maintenance issues (cooling system, suspension components)
- • Rust can be an issue, particularly on rear arches and tailgate
- • Higher fuel consumption for larger petrol engines
- • Some electrical gremlins can occur with age
- • Entry-level engines can feel underpowered with automatic transmissions
